Factors to Consider When Choosing Best Expandable Portable Power Station For Camping
Choosing the best expandable portable power station for camping involves balancing multiple factors. Beyond just capacity, consider how portable the device is, how it integrates with solar panels, and what features are most relevant to your camping style. Making the right choice can mean the difference between reliable power and constant frustration in the wilderness. Here are some key considerations to guide your decision.
Capacity and Expandability
Determine your typical power needs—whether for charging phones, running small appliances, or powering larger devices. Expandability allows you to increase capacity with additional batteries, which is essential for longer trips. However, larger capacity units tend to be heavier and bulkier, so consider how much portability you need versus total power. Think about future needs as well—if you plan to extend your camping adventures, investing in a more expandable system makes sense.
Portability and Size
While larger capacity often means more weight, some models strike a good balance with lightweight materials and compact design. If you’re backpacking or prefer a lightweight setup, smaller units like the Jackery Explorer 300 may suffice, but with limited expandability. Conversely, vehicle campers can carry bigger units like the Pecron E2000LFP, which provide more power without the concern of weight. Assess how much space and weight you’re willing to handle, especially for extended trips.
Solar Compatibility
Solar input capability allows for sustainable recharging, especially useful in remote locations. Not all units support solar charging or handle high input wattages, so check compatibility with your panels. Keep in mind that adding solar panels increases setup complexity and cost but offers the advantage of continuous, off-grid power. Consider whether solar charging is a priority or a bonus, and choose a model that matches your preferred recharge method.
Battery Chemistry and Durability
LiFePO4 batteries are increasingly common in high-quality power stations due to their longer lifespan and safer chemistry compared to traditional lithium-ion. These batteries withstand more charge cycles, making them ideal for frequent outdoor use. However, they tend to be more expensive upfront. Investing in a unit with robust battery chemistry can save money and hassle over time, especially if you camp regularly or rely heavily on your power station.
Additional Features
Features like multiple AC outlets, fast charging, USB-C ports, and jump-start capabilities add significant convenience. Some models include built-in inverters with high surge capacity, suitable for powering appliances and tools. Evaluate which features align with your camping style—if you need to power a small fridge or CPAP machine, prioritize units with higher surge ratings and multiple outlets. Remember that more features often come with increased cost and weight, so choose what genuinely adds value for your needs.

How long can I run devices on a fully charged power station?
The runtime depends on the capacity of the battery and the power consumption of your devices. For example, a 1024Wh unit can theoretically run a 100W device for around 10 hours, but actual time will vary based on efficiency and load. Larger capacity models like the Pecron E2000LFP can extend this significantly, especially if you manage power usage carefully. Always consider your typical power draw to estimate how long a station can sustain your needs.

How important is battery chemistry for outdoor use?
Battery chemistry directly impacts safety, lifespan, and performance. LiFePO4 batteries are favored in outdoor power stations because they offer longer cycle life, better thermal stability, and enhanced safety over traditional lithium-ion batteries. This durability means fewer replacements and less risk of overheating or fires, which is vital when relying on a portable power source in remote locations. Investing in a unit with robust chemistry can be a key factor in ensuring reliable, safe operation over many trips.
